Shotwell 0.32.6 on Ubuntu 24.04.2 Face recognition menu item missing and functionality not working
On Shotwell 0.32.6 on Ubuntu 24.04.2, face detection functionality doesn't work and the "Detect Faces" menu item is missing.
The expected behaviour
A "Detect Faces" option to be available in a menu or right-click menu. The 'Faces in Photos' page of the Shotwell documentation says a 'Detect Faces' option should be available to click on but it does not state where it is located.
Or there should be some other way to detect the faces in the photo library.
Note, the steps under "Improving face recognition" on the 'Faces in Photos' page have been followed.
What was actually happening
No 'Detect Faces' menu entry or button can be found.
The Faces menu item only contains options to Remove (a face tag), Rename, Train or Delete - no detect. Right clicking on the sidebar on a name under 'Faces' offers Rename or Delete.
Other menu items have all been checked including Photos->Developer, Tags, Faces, Help etc
Steps to reproduce the issue
- Open Shotwell 0.32.6 from noble-updates repo
- Import photos to library
- double click on photo of a person
- Click on 'Faces' on bottom bar to add a face tag eg "Bob". Double click on photo to close.
- Click on menu Faces->Train Face 'Bob' from photo
Now try to get Shotwell to find other photos of "Bob"
